site stats

Pinia actions 同步

WebApr 10, 2024 · 简介. Pinia 起始 于 2024 年 11 月左右的一次实验,其目的是设计一个拥有 组合式 API 的 Vue 状态管理库。. 从那时起,我们就倾向于同时支持 Vue 2 和 Vue 3,并且不强制要求开发者使用组合式 API,我们的初心至今没有改变。. 除了 安装 和 SSR 两章之外,其 … Web4.只剩下state(负责存储数据),getters(定义计算方法),actions(定义异步方法) 5.actions支持同步和异步 6.代码扁平化没有模块嵌套,只有store的概念,且每一个store是独立的,stoer之间可以自由使用

Pinia The intuitive store for Vue.js

Web可通过事务、同步本地存储等方式扩展 Pinia,以响应 store 的变更。 🏗 模块化设计 可构建多个 Store 并允许你的打包工具自动拆分它们。 WebApr 3, 2024 · actions的使用 动作相当于组件中的方法。它们可以使用actionsin 属性进行定义。 并且在pinia中的action既可以有同步函数也可以有异步函数。 在actions中可以通过this访问该仓库所有实例 export … fruit gushers commercial 2004 https://bubershop.com

一文带你上手Vue新的状态管理Pinia - 编程宝库

WebPinia 核心特性. 1.Pinia 没有 Mutations. 2.Actions支持同步和异步. 3.没有模块的嵌套结构. Pinia 通过设计提供扁平结构,就是说每个 store 都是互相独立的,谁也不属于谁,也就是 … Web前言 Pinia.js 是新一代的状态管理器,由 Vue.js团队中成员所开发的,因此也被认为是下一代的 Vuex,即 Vuex5.x,在 Vue3.0 的项目中使用也是备受推崇。 Pinia.js ... actions 支持 … WebFeb 24, 2024 · Pinia的代码分割: 打包时,Pinia会检查引用依赖,当首页用到job store,打包只会把用到的store和页面合并输出1个js chunk,其他2个store不耦合在其中。Pinia能 … giddy blue : a story of the manybyjohn morgan

Vue3中pinia使用及状态持久化存储 - 盼星星盼太阳 - 博客园

Category:Pinia相比Vuex、哪个更好用? - 知乎

Tags:Pinia actions 同步

Pinia actions 同步

Actions Pinia - Vue.js

WebPinia: State、Gettes、Actions(同步异步都支持) Vuex 当前最新版是 4.x. Vuex4 用于 Vue3; Vuex3 用于 Vue2; Pinia 当前最新版是 2.x. 即支持 Vue2 也支持 Vue3; 就目前而言 Pinia 比 Vuex 好太多了,解决了 Vuex 的很多问题,所以笔者也非常建议直接使用 Pinia,尤其是 TypeScript 的项目 ...

Pinia actions 同步

Did you know?

WebPinia 与 Vue devtools 挂钩,不会影响 Vue 3 ... Pinia 让 Actions 更加的灵活. 可以通过组件或其他 action 调用; 可以从其他 store 的 action 中调用; 直接在商店实例上调用; 支持同步 ... WebMar 14, 2024 · Vue Pinia 是一个状态管理库,可以用来管理 Vue.js 应用程序中的状态。. 下面是使用 Vue Pinia 的一些基本步骤:. 安装 Vue Pinia. 你可以通过 npm 或 yarn 来安装 Vue Pinia:. npm install pinia. 或者. yarn add pinia. 创建 Pinia 实例. 在 Vue 应用程序的入口文件中,创建一个 Pinia 实例 ...

WebApr 14, 2024 · pinia-plugin-persistedstate 是一个 Pinia 插件,用于在浏览器中持久化存储 Pinia 状态。它可以将状态存储在本地存储(localStorage)或会话存储(sessionStorage)中,并在页面刷新或重新加载后自动恢复状态。这个插件可以帮助开发者更方便地管理应用程序的状态,并提高用户体验。 WebMar 16, 2024 · Pinia 没有 Mutations; Actions 支持同步和异步; 没有模块的嵌套结构. Pinia 通过设计提供扁平结构,就是说每个 store 都是互相独立的,谁也不属于谁,也就是扁平化 …

WebMay 5, 2024 · 2.利用持久化工具 pinia-plugin-persist. 安装. npm i pinia-plugin-persist --save. main.js引入. // 引入pinia仓库 import { createPinia } from 'pinia' // 持久化存储pinia import piniaPluginPersist from 'pinia-plugin-persist' const store = createPinia () store.use (piniaPluginPersist) const app = createApp (App) app.use (store ... Webpinia和route的基本使用. 喜讯 美格智能荣获2024“物联之星”年度榜单之中国物联网企业100强

WebAug 6, 2024 · pinia方法调用之Actions cv大魔王 2024-08-06 pinia vue3 在vuex中调用方法分为异步调用和同步调用,从我个人来说我认为是非常奇怪的,庆幸的是在pinia中改变了这 …

WebMay 30, 2024 · pinia同样支持vue开发者工具,最新的开发者工具对vuex4支持不好. pinia核心概念. state: 状态. actions: 修改状态(包括同步和异步,pinia中没有mutations) getters: 计算属性. 基本使用与state. 目标:掌握pinia的使用步骤 (1)安装. yarn add pinia # or npm i pinia (2)在main.js中挂载pinia fruit gushers commercial 2006WebMar 18, 2024 · Pinia: State、Gettes、Actions(同步异步都支持) Vuex 当前最新版是 4.x. Vuex4 用于 Vue3; Vuex3 用于 Vue2; Pinia 当前最新版是 2.x. 即支持 Vue2 也支持 Vue3; 就目前而言 Pinia 比 Vuex 好太多了,解决了 Vuex 的很多问题,所以笔者也非常建议直接使用 Pinia,尤其是 TypeScript 的项目 ... fruit gushers commercial 2009Web幸运汉克. 主演:鲍勃·奥登科克,米瑞·伊诺丝,奥利维亚·韦尔奇,戴德里克·巴德,萨拉·阿米尼,塞德里克·亚伯勒,苏珊·克莱尔,克里斯·格哈德,杰克森·凯利,海莉·塞尔斯,杰姬·古恩,阿瑟·肯,卡罗琳·亚代尔,罗曼·金赛拉,马诺·苏德,马克·克里斯科,加布里埃尔·卡特,杰奎琳·安·斯图尔特,达斯汀·怀特 ... giddy blossom archange azraelWebNov 5, 2024 · 使用Pinia. defineStore ( ) 方法的第一个参数:容器的名字,名字必须唯一,不能重复. defineStore ( ) 方法的第二个参数:配置对象,放置state,getters,actions. state 属性: 用来存储全局的状态. getters 属性: 用来监视或者说是计算状态的变化的,有缓存的功 … fruit gusher juiceWebPinia 核心特性. 1.Pinia 没有 Mutations. 2.Actions支持同步和异步. 3.没有模块的嵌套结构. Pinia 通过设计提供扁平结构,就是说每个 store 都是互相独立的,谁也不属于谁,也就是扁平化了,更好的代码分割且没有命名空间。. 当然你也可以通过在一个模块中导入另一个 ... fruit gushers big bagWebMar 9, 2024 · pinia 中 action 支持同步和异步,Vuex 中 action 中做异步处理,mutation 中做同步处理。 p ini a 支持 TypeScript。 Vue3 推荐使用 TS 来编写,此时使用 p ini a 就非常 … giddy austin txWebPinia 是 Vue 的存储库,它允许您跨组件/页面共享状态。 从上面官网的解释不难看出,pinia和Vuex的作用是一样的,它也充当的是一个存储数据的作用,存储在pinia的数据允许我们在各个组件中使用。 giddy beauty